How to Make Creamy Garlic Chicken & Parmesan Pasta Delight Recipe

Step 1: Season and Sear the Chicken

Start by seasoning your chicken chunks generously with sal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ning. This not only brings out the natural flavor but also sets the stage for a beautifully seasoned dish. Heat olive oil in a skillet until shimmering, then add the chicken. Sear each piece until golden brown and cooked through. The crispy edges lock in juices and develop a deep flavor that’s simply irresistible. Once done, remove the chicken and set it aside for later.

Step 2: Cook the Rigatoni to Al Dente

Next, bring salted water to a boil and add your rigatoni. Cooking it al dente ensures a firm bite that contrasts wonderfully with the creamy sauce. Don’t forget to reserve about half a cup of pasta water before draining—this starchy liquid is essential for bringing the sauce together later.

Step 3: Sauté Garlic in Butter

Lower the heat on your skillet and melt the butter in it. Add the minced garlic and sauté for just 30 seconds until fragrant, being careful not to burn it. This quick step releases the aromatic sweetness of garlic, laying the delicious foundation of your creamy sauce.

Step 4: Create the Creamy Sauce

Pour in the heavy cream and let it gently simmer on low heat. Slowly whisk in the freshly grated parmesan cheese, allowing it to melt smoothly into the cream. This process thickens the sauce and makes it perfectly creamy, with that cheesy richness you’re craving. If the sauce feels too thick, add reserved pasta water a little at a time to reach your desired consistency.

Step 5: Combine Chicken, Pasta, and Sauce

Return the golden chicken pieces to the skillet and add the cooked rigatoni pasta. Toss everything together until each piece of pasta and chicken is gloriously coated in the creamy garlic parmesan sauce. This step unites all the flavors and textures into one comforting dish that is juicy, cheesy, and bursting with garlicky goodness.

Step 6: Garnish and Serve

Finish your masterpiece by garnishing with extra parmesan cheese and a sprinkling of chopped fresh parsley for a pop of color and fresh herbal brightness. Serve immediately while it’s warm and irresistibly creamy.

Make Ahead and Storage

Storing Leftovers

Place any uneaten Creamy Garlic Chicken & Parmesan Pasta Delight Recipe into an airtight container and refrigerate it for up to 3 days. The flavors tend to meld even more after resting overnight, which makes for a tasty next-day meal. Just be sure to store it properly to maintain the sauce’s creamy texture.

Freezing

While this dish is best fresh, you can freeze leftovers if needed. Transfer cooled pasta into a freezer-safe container and freeze for up to 2 months. Keep in mind that the texture of the cream sauce might change slightly upon thawing, so freezing is best reserved for emergencies or meal prep.

Reheating

Reheat gently on the stovetop over low heat, adding a splash of milk or cream to refresh the sauce and prevent it from drying out. Stir often to ensure even warming and to bring back that creamy consistency. Avoid microwaving at high power as it may cause separation of the sauce.

FAQs

Can I use a different type of pasta for this recipe?

Absolutely! While rigatoni is ideal because of its ridges and size, penne, fusilli, or even fettuccine will work beautifully. Just adjust cooking times accordingly.

Is there a way to lighten up the sauce without losing creaminess?

Yes, swapping heavy cream for half-and-half or a mixture of milk and Greek yogurt can reduce fat content while maintaining a creamy texture. Just be cautious with heat to prevent curdling.

Can I make this recipe dairy-free?

You can! Use dairy-free cream substitutes and vegan parmesan alternatives. The flavor and texture will be slightly different but still delicious and creamy with some tweaking.

How do I get the chicken extra tender and flavorful?

Try marinating the chicken briefly in olive oil, garlic, and herbs before cooking, or pound it slightly for even thickness. Cooking over medium-high heat ensures a golden crust while locking in juices.

Is this recipe suitable for meal prepping?

Definitely. It stores and reheats well, making it perfect for packing lunches or quick dinners throughout the week. Just keep pasta and sauce separate if you want to maintain texture during storage.

Creamy Garlic Chicken & Parmesan Pasta Delight Recipe

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 20 minutes
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ings
  • Category: Main Course
  • Method: Stovetop
  • Cuisine: Italian

Description

This Creamy Garlic Chicken & Parmesan Pasta Delight is a quick and comforting dish combining tender seared chicken with al dente rigatoni pasta in a rich garlic parmesan cream sauce. Perfect for a weeknight dinner, it offers a luscious texture with fresh herbs and classic Italian seasoning for a flavorful meal that serves four in just 30 minutes.


Ingredients

Scale

Chicken

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ized chunks
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ning

Pasta

  • 10 oz rigatoni pasta
  • Salt for pasta water

Sauce

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 3 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up freshly grated parmesan cheese

Garnish

  • Chopped fresh parsley (optional)
  • Extra parmesan cheese (optional)


Instructions

  1. Season Chicken: Season the bite-sized chicken chunks with salt, black pepper, and Italian seasoning, ensuring each piece is well-coated for maximum flavor.
  2. Sear Chicken: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add the seasoned chicken and sear until golden brown and fully cooked through, about 5-7 minutes.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
  3. Cook Pasta: In a large pot, bring salted water to a boil and cook rigatoni pasta until al dente according to package instructions, usually about 10-12 minutes. Reserve 1/2 cup of pasta cooking water before draining.
  4. Sauté Garlic: Lower the skillet heat to medium-low and melt the butter. Add minced garlic to the skillet and sauté for about 30 seconds or until fragrant, taking care not to burn it.
  5. Make Cream Sauce: Pour the heavy cream into the skillet with garlic and bring it to a gentle simmer, stirring occasionally to combine the flavors.
  6. Add Parmesan: Gradually whisk in the freshly grated parmesan cheese until the sauce becomes smooth and creamy.
  7. Toss Together: Return the cooked chicken to the skillet, then add the drained pasta. Toss everything together to evenly coat the pasta and chicken with the creamy sauce. If the sauce is too thick, add reserved pasta water a little at a time until the desired consistency is reached.
  8. Garnish and Serve: Sprinkle extra parmesan cheese and chopped fresh parsley over the dish if desired. Serve immediately for the best flavor and texture.

Notes

  • For extra flavor, marinate the chicken in Italian seasoning and olive oil for 15 minutes before cooking.
  • If you prefer a lighter sauce, substitute half the heavy cream with milk or use half-and-half.
  • Reserve pasta water is key to adjust the sauce’s thickness; add gradually for desired creaminess.
  • Use freshly grated parmesan for best taste and smooth sauce texture rather than pre-grated cheese.
  • Garnish with chopped parsley adds a fresh color and subtle herbal note but is optional.
